Klitschko winning Kyiv mayoral election with 65.5% of vote
Kyiv Mayor Vitali Klitschko is leading in the mayoral election after 83.5% of protocols issued by district election commissions have been processed. The information has been posted on the display screen at the Kyiv City Elections Commission.
According to the preliminary information, Klitschko has gained 65.5% vote, and his rival, people's deputy Boryslav Bereza has 32.8%.
As of now, eight out of ten district election commissions have submitted ballot protocols to the City Elections Commission.
